Children take fizzy drink challenge

School pupils in Blackpool, Lancashire, have been seeing if they could give up sugar-laden fizzy drinks for 21 days.

Blackpool has some of the highest rates of overweight and obese children and teenagers in the country.

It is hoped that in the long term the scheme will help the teenagers cut down on how many calories they consume.

BBC News joined a group of the young people to see how they got on.
